On October 9, 2008, Dickie Hamilton became the first of three workers to die on Wanzek wind energy projects. The Oklahoman reports on his death, which occurred near Grafton, Iowa.
MASON CITY, Iowa — The Iowa Division of Labor Services said it plans to issue three citations to a construction company for a wind farm accident Oct. 9 that killed an Oklahoma man.
Dick Hamilton, 46, of Tishmingo was injured when a fork lift ran over him at the Barton Windmill Project. Hamilton later died of his injuries.
Wanzek Construction of Fargo, N.D., failed to ensure that its employees had completed training, Iowa safety officials said.
